Child Psychiatry: Children Deserve Great Mental Health

Child psychiatry is a vital field that focuses on diagnosing and treating behavioral and mental health disorders in children and adolescents. It is crucial to address these issues early in life to prevent them from escalating and affecting long-term well-being. Child psychiatrists use a variety of treatments including therapy, medication, and comprehensive intervention plans tailored to each child’s unique needs. By fostering a supportive environment, child psychiatry aims to help young individuals develop into mentally healthy adults.

Insomnia Solutions: Overcoming Sleep Deprivation

Insomnia solutions focus on addressing the difficulties in falling or staying asleep. Treatment often includes behavioral strategies, such as sleep hygiene education and relaxation techniques, as well as cognitive-behavioral therapy for insomnia (CBT-I). These approaches help individuals establish healthy sleep patterns, which is crucial for both physical and mental health.

Managing OCD: Professional OCD Assessments

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der (OCD) is characterized by unwanted and intrusive thoughts that drive repetitive behaviors. Managing OCD involves professional assessments followed by targeted treatment strategies, including cognitive-behavioral therapy and sometimes medication. These treatments help reduce the severity of OCD symptoms, improving quality of life for those affected.
